According to papers from KCC you need police certificate from all countries you lived for more than 6 months. I have lived in US for over 3 years that's why I decided to request FBI background check. I prefer to have all papers on interview even if some of them might not be necessary.

I am doing consular processing (not AOS). They require that you bring police certificate (FBI background check) to your interview, so I had to do request on my own. You pay FBI by money order to check your fingerprints and they send result back to you.

I sent my request for background check to FBI in September 2004 and got result at the beginnig of January 2005, so it takes around 4-5 months for them to check your fingerprints.
